Transaction f9331d8600d4c339da12e18c2185ae41601dbaa010d4a5d1924cd8be2431afc9
1 Input
1 Output
-
f9331d8600d4c339da12e18c2185ae41601dbaa010d4a5d1924cd8be2431afc9:0
- value
- 529098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cdb0f501b2b11c1321a0a6d7e8a3771ec47932f OP_EQUAL
- address
- 3FzPm1f947W8cnrPqxBBRmkXZ39Yw9hqSg